%define upstream_name Task-Dist-Zilla %define upstream_version 1.110760 Name: perl-%{upstream_name} Version: %perl_convert_version %{upstream_version} Release: %mkrel 1 Summary: Task to install dist-zilla and all its plugins License: GPL+ or Artistic Group: Development/Perl Url: http://search.cpan.org/dist/%{upstream_name} Source0: http://www.cpan.org/modules/by-module/Task/%{upstream_name}-%{upstream_version}.tar.gz BuildRequires: perl(Dist::Zilla) BuildRequires: perl(Dist::Zilla::Plugin::ApacheTest) BuildRequires: perl(Dist::Zilla::Plugin::ApocalypseTests) BuildRequires: perl(Dist::Zilla::Plugin::AppendExternalData) BuildRequires: perl(Dist::Zilla::Plugin::ArchiveRelease) BuildRequires: perl(Dist::Zilla::Plugin::AssertOS) BuildRequires: perl(Dist::Zilla::Plugin::Author::KENTNL::DistINI) BuildRequires: perl(Dist::Zilla::Plugin::Authority) BuildRequires: perl(Dist::Zilla::Plugin::AutoMetaResources) BuildRequires: perl(Dist::Zilla::Plugin::AutoVersion::Relative) BuildRequires: perl(Dist::Zilla::Plugin::BeJROCKWAY) BuildRequires: perl(Dist::Zilla::Plugin::Bootstrap::lib) BuildRequires: perl(Dist::Zilla::Plugin::Bugtracker) BuildRequires: perl(Dist::Zilla::Plugin::BuildFile) BuildRequires: perl(Dist::Zilla::Plugin::BumpVersionFromGit) BuildRequires: perl(Dist::Zilla::Plugin::CPANChangesTests) BuildRequires: perl(Dist::Zilla::Plugin::CSJEWELL::AuthorTest) BuildRequires: perl(Dist::Zilla::Plugin::CSJEWELL::BeforeBuild) BuildRequires: perl(Dist::Zilla::Plugin::CSJEWELL::DotFileFix) BuildRequires: perl(Dist::Zilla::Plugin::CSJEWELL::FTPUploadToOwnSite) BuildRequires: perl(Dist::Zilla::Plugin::CSJEWELL::SubversionDist) BuildRequires: perl(Dist::Zilla::Plugin::CSJEWELL::VersionGetter) BuildRequires: perl(Dist::Zilla::Plugin::Catalyst) BuildRequires: perl(Dist::Zilla::Plugin::Catalyst::New) BuildRequires: perl(Dist::Zilla::Plugin::ChangelogFromGit) BuildRequires: perl(Dist::Zilla::Plugin::CheckChangeLog) BuildRequires: perl(Dist::Zilla::Plugin::CheckChangesHasContent) BuildRequires: perl(Dist::Zilla::Plugin::CheckChangesTests) BuildRequires: perl(Dist::Zilla::Plugin::CheckExtraTests) BuildRequires: perl(Dist::Zilla::Plugin::CheckPrereqsIndexed) BuildRequires: perl(Dist::Zilla::Plugin::CompileTests) BuildRequires: perl(Dist::Zilla::Plugin::Conflicts) BuildRequires: perl(Dist::Zilla::Plugin::ConsistentVersionTest) BuildRequires: perl(Dist::Zilla::Plugin::CopyFilesFromBuild) BuildRequires: perl(Dist::Zilla::Plugin::CopyMakefilePLFromBuild) BuildRequires: perl(Dist::Zilla::Plugin::CopyReadmeFromBuild) BuildRequires: perl(Dist::Zilla::Plugin::CopyTo) BuildRequires: perl(Dist::Zilla::Plugin::CriticTests) BuildRequires: perl(Dist::Zilla::Plugin::CustomLicense) BuildRequires: perl(Dist::Zilla::Plugin::Deb::VersionFromChangelog) BuildRequires: perl(Dist::Zilla::Plugin::DistManifestTests) BuildRequires: perl(Dist::Zilla::Plugin::Doppelgaenger) BuildRequires: perl(Dist::Zilla::Plugin::DualBuilders) BuildRequires: perl(Dist::Zilla::Plugin::DualLife) BuildRequires: perl(Dist::Zilla::Plugin::DynamicManifest) BuildRequires: perl(Dist::Zilla::Plugin::EOLTests) BuildRequires: perl(Dist::Zilla::Plugin::FatPacker) BuildRequires: perl(Dist::Zilla::Plugin::FileKeywords) BuildRequires: perl(Dist::Zilla::Plugin::FileKeywords::Standard) BuildRequires: perl(Dist::Zilla::Plugin::FindDirByRegex) BuildRequires: perl(Dist::Zilla::Plugin::GatherFromManifest) BuildRequires: perl(Dist::Zilla::Plugin::Git) BuildRequires: perl(Dist::Zilla::Plugin::Git::Check) BuildRequires: perl(Dist::Zilla::Plugin::Git::Commit) BuildRequires: perl(Dist::Zilla::Plugin::Git::CommitBuild) BuildRequires: perl(Dist::Zilla::Plugin::Git::DescribeVersion) BuildRequires: perl(Dist::Zilla::Plugin::Git::Init) BuildRequires: perl(Dist::Zilla::Plugin::Git::NextVersion) BuildRequires: perl(Dist::Zilla::Plugin::Git::Push) BuildRequires: perl(Dist::Zilla::Plugin::Git::Tag) BuildRequires: perl(Dist::Zilla::Plugin::Git::Tag::ForRelease) BuildRequires: perl(Dist::Zilla::Plugin::GitFmtChanges) BuildRequires: perl(Dist::Zilla::Plugin::GitHub) BuildRequires: perl(Dist::Zilla::Plugin::GitHub::Create) BuildRequires: perl(Dist::Zilla::Plugin::GitHub::Meta) BuildRequires: perl(Dist::Zilla::Plugin::GitHub::Update) BuildRequires: perl(Dist::Zilla::Plugin::GitObtain) BuildRequires: perl(Dist::Zilla::Plugin::GitVersionCheckCJM) BuildRequires: perl(Dist::Zilla::Plugin::GithubMeta) BuildRequires: perl(Dist::Zilla::Plugin::GithubUpdate) BuildRequires: perl(Dist::Zilla::Plugin::HasVersionTests) BuildRequires: perl(Dist::Zilla::Plugin::Homepage) BuildRequires: perl(Dist::Zilla::Plugin::Inject) BuildRequires: perl(Dist::Zilla::Plugin::InlineFilesMARCEL) BuildRequires: perl(Dist::Zilla::Plugin::InstallGuide) BuildRequires: perl(Dist::Zilla::Plugin::InstallRelease) BuildRequires: perl(Dist::Zilla::Plugin::JSAN)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::Bundle)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::GatherDir::Template)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::GitHubDocs)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::InstallInstructions)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::Minter)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::NPM)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::NPM::Publish)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::PkgVersion)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::ReadmeFromMD) BuildRequires: perl(Dist::Zilla::Plugin::JSAN::StaticDir) BuildRequires: perl(Dist::Zilla::Plugin::KwaliteeTests) BuildRequires: perl(Dist::Zilla::Plugin::LatestPrereqs) BuildRequires: perl(Dist::Zilla::Plugin::LocaleMsgfmt) BuildRequires: perl(Dist::Zilla::Plugin::MakeMaker::Awesome) BuildRequires: perl(Dist::Zilla::Plugin::MakeMaker::SkipInstall) BuildRequires: perl(Dist::Zilla::Plugin::MatchManifest) BuildRequires: perl(Dist::Zilla::Plugin::Mercurial) BuildRequires: perl(Dist::Zilla::Plugin::Mercurial::Check) BuildRequires: perl(Dist::Zilla::Plugin::Mercurial::Push) BuildRequires: perl(Dist::Zilla::Plugin::Mercurial::Tag) BuildRequires: perl(Dist::Zilla::Plugin::MetaData::BuiltWith) BuildRequires: perl(Dist::Zilla::Plugin::MetaData::BuiltWith::All) BuildRequires: perl(Dist::Zilla::Plugin::MetaProvides) BuildRequires: perl(Dist::Zilla::Plugin::MetaProvides::Class) BuildRequires: perl(Dist::Zilla::Plugin::MetaProvides::FromFile) BuildRequires: perl(Dist::Zilla::Plugin::MetaProvides::Package) BuildRequires: perl(Dist::Zilla::Plugin::MetaResourcesFromGit) BuildRequires: perl(Dist::Zilla::Plugin::Metadata) BuildRequires: perl(Dist::Zilla::Plugin::MinimumPerl) BuildRequires: perl(Dist::Zilla::Plugin::MinimumVersionTests) BuildRequires: perl(Dist::Zilla::Plugin::ModuleBuild::Custom) BuildRequires: perl(Dist::Zilla::Plugin::ModuleBuild::XSOrPP) BuildRequires: perl(Dist::Zilla::Plugin::ModuleInstall) BuildRequires: perl(Dist::Zilla::Plugin::NoAutomatedTesting) BuildRequires: perl(Dist::Zilla::Plugin::NoSmartCommentsTests) BuildRequires: perl(Dist::Zilla::Plugin::NoTabsTests) BuildRequires: perl(Dist::Zilla::Plugin::OSPrereqs) BuildRequires: perl(Dist::Zilla::Plugin::OurPkgVersion) BuildRequires: perl(Dist::Zilla::Plugin::PerlTidy) BuildRequires: perl(Dist::Zilla::Plugin::PickyPodWeaver) BuildRequires: perl(Dist::Zilla::Plugin::PodLinkTests) BuildRequires: perl(Dist::Zilla::Plugin::PodLoom) BuildRequires: perl(Dist::Zilla::Plugin::PodPurler) BuildRequires: perl(Dist::Zilla::Plugin::PodSpellingTests) BuildRequires: perl(Dist::Zilla::Plugin::PodWeaver) BuildRequires: perl(Dist::Zilla::Plugin::PortabilityTests) BuildRequires: perl(Dist::Zilla::Plugin::Prepender) BuildRequires: perl(Dist::Zilla::Plugin::ProgCriticTests) BuildRequires: perl(Dist::Zilla::Plugin::PurePerlTests) BuildRequires: perl(Dist::Zilla::Plugin::ReadmeAnyFromPod) BuildRequires: perl(Dist::Zilla::Plugin::ReadmeFromPod) BuildRequires: perl(Dist::Zilla::Plugin::ReadmeMarkdownFromPod) BuildRequires: perl(Dist::Zilla::Plugin::ReportPhase) BuildRequires: perl(Dist::Zilla::Plugin::ReportVersions) BuildRequires: perl(Dist::Zilla::Plugin::ReportVersions::Tiny) BuildRequires: perl(Dist::Zilla::Plugin::Repository) BuildRequires: perl(Dist::Zilla::Plugin::RequiresExternal) BuildRequires: perl(Dist::Zilla::Plugin::Rsync) BuildRequires: perl(Dist::Zilla::Plugin::Run) BuildRequires: perl(Dist::Zilla::Plugin::Run::AfterBuild) BuildRequires: perl(Dist::Zilla::Plugin::Run::AfterRelease) BuildRequires: perl(Dist::Zilla::Plugin::Run::BeforeBuild) BuildRequires: perl(Dist::Zilla::Plugin::Run::BeforeRelease) BuildRequires: perl(Dist::Zilla::Plugin::Run::Release) BuildRequires: perl(Dist::Zilla::Plugin::Run::Role::Runner) BuildRequires: perl(Dist::Zilla::Plugin::SVK) BuildRequires: perl(Dist::Zilla::Plugin::SVK::Check) BuildRequires: perl(Dist::Zilla::Plugin::SVK::Commit) BuildRequires: perl(Dist::Zilla::Plugin::SVK::Push) BuildRequires: perl(Dist::Zilla::Plugin::SVK::Tag) BuildRequires: perl(Dist::Zilla::Plugin::Signature) BuildRequires: perl(Dist::Zilla::Plugin::StaticVersion) BuildRequires: perl(Dist::Zilla::Plugin::SubmittingPatches) BuildRequires: perl(Dist::Zilla::Plugin::Subversion) BuildRequires: perl(Dist::Zilla::Plugin::Subversion::ReleaseDist) BuildRequires: perl(Dist::Zilla::Plugin::Subversion::Tag) BuildRequires: perl(Dist::Zilla::Plugin::SurgicalPkgVersion) BuildRequires: perl(Dist::Zilla::Plugin::SurgicalPodWeaver) BuildRequires: perl(Dist::Zilla::Plugin::SvnObtain) BuildRequires: perl(Dist::Zilla::Plugin::SynopsisTests) BuildRequires: perl(Dist::Zilla::Plugin::TaskWeaver) BuildRequires: perl(Dist::Zilla::Plugin::TemplateCJM) BuildRequires: perl(Dist::Zilla::Plugin::TemplateFiles) BuildRequires: perl(Dist::Zilla::Plugin::Twitter) BuildRequires: perl(Dist::Zilla::Plugin::UnusedVarsTests) BuildRequires: perl(Dist::Zilla::Plugin::UpdateGitHub) BuildRequires: perl(Dist::Zilla::Plugin::VersionFromModule) BuildRequires: perl(Dist::Zilla::Plugin::WSDL) BuildRequires: perl(Dist::Zilla::Plugin::WSDL::Types) BuildRequires: perl(Dist::Zilla::PluginBundle::AJGB) BuildRequires: perl(Dist::Zilla::PluginBundle::AVAR) BuildRequires: perl(Dist::Zilla::PluginBundle::Author::DOHERTY) BuildRequires: perl(Dist::Zilla::PluginBundle::Author::KENTNL) BuildRequires: perl(Dist::Zilla::PluginBundle::Author::KENTNL::Lite) BuildRequires: perl(Dist::Zilla::PluginBundle::Author::LESPEA) BuildRequires: perl(Dist::Zilla::PluginBundle::Author::OLIVER) BuildRequires: perl(Dist::Zilla::PluginBundle::BINGOS) BuildRequires: perl(Dist::Zilla::PluginBundle::CEBJYRE) BuildRequires: perl(Dist::Zilla::PluginBundle::CJM) BuildRequires: perl(Dist::Zilla::PluginBundle::CSJEWELL) BuildRequires: perl(Dist::Zilla::PluginBundle::DAGOLDEN) BuildRequires: perl(Dist::Zilla::PluginBundle::DANIELP) BuildRequires: perl(Dist::Zilla::PluginBundle::DOY) BuildRequires: perl(Dist::Zilla::PluginBundle::FAYLAND) BuildRequires: perl(Dist::Zilla::PluginBundle::FLORA) BuildRequires: perl(Dist::Zilla::PluginBundle::GENEHACK) BuildRequires: perl(Dist::Zilla::PluginBundle::GETTY) BuildRequires: perl(Dist::Zilla::PluginBundle::Git) BuildRequires: perl(Dist::Zilla::PluginBundle::GitHub) BuildRequires: perl(Dist::Zilla::PluginBundle::GopherRepellent) BuildRequires: perl(Dist::Zilla::PluginBundle::IDOPEREL) BuildRequires: perl(Dist::Zilla::PluginBundle::JQUELIN) BuildRequires: perl(Dist::Zilla::PluginBundle::JROCKWAY) BuildRequires: perl(Dist::Zilla::PluginBundle::MARCEL) BuildRequires: perl(Dist::Zilla::PluginBundle::MSCHOUT) BuildRequires: perl(Dist::Zilla::PluginBundle::Mercurial) BuildRequires: perl(Dist::Zilla::PluginBundle::NIGELM) BuildRequires: perl(Dist::Zilla::PluginBundle::NUFFIN) BuildRequires: perl(Dist::Zilla::PluginBundle::PDONELAN) BuildRequires: perl(Dist::Zilla::PluginBundle::PadrePlugin) BuildRequires: perl(Dist::Zilla::PluginBundle::RBO) BuildRequires: perl(Dist::Zilla::PluginBundle::RBUELS) BuildRequires: perl(Dist::Zilla::PluginBundle::RJBS) BuildRequires: perl(Dist::Zilla::PluginBundle::ROKR) BuildRequires: perl(Dist::Zilla::PluginBundle::ROKR::Basic) BuildRequires: perl(Dist::Zilla::PluginBundle::RTHOMPSON) BuildRequires: perl(Dist::Zilla::PluginBundle::Rakudo) BuildRequires: perl(Dist::Zilla::PluginBundle::SVK) BuildRequires: perl(Dist::Zilla::PluginBundle::TestingMania) BuildRequires: perl(Dist::Zilla::PluginBundle::WOLVERIAN) BuildRequires: perl(Dist::Zilla::PluginBundle::YANICK) BuildRequires: perl(File::Find) BuildRequires: perl(File::Temp) BuildRequires: perl(Module::Build) >= 0.360.100 BuildRequires: perl(Test::More) >= 0.880.0 BuildArch: noarch %description This task is merely a placeholder to pull all dist-zilla related modules in one go. %prep %setup -q -n %{upstream_name}-%{upstream_version} %build %{__perl} Build.PL installdirs=vendor ./Build %check ./Build test %install rm -rf %{buildroot} ./Build install destdir=%{buildroot} %clean rm -rf %buildroot %files %defattr(-,root,root) %doc Changes LICENSE META.json META.yml README %{_mandir}/man3/* %perl_vendorlib/*